public class SwaggerUtil extends Object
| 构造器和说明 |
|---|
SwaggerUtil() |
| 限定符和类型 | 方法和说明 |
|---|---|
static String[] |
basePackages(List<String> basePackage)
解析basePackage
|
static BuildSecuritySchemes |
buildSecuritySchemes(List<SwaggerSecurityScheme> swaggerSecuritySchemes)
OpenAPI 规范中支持的安全方案是
参考
HTTP 身份验证
API key (作为 Header 或 查询参数)
OAuth2 的通用流程(implicit, password, application and access code),如RFC6749
OpenID Connect Discovery
在 java 中的抽象类型对应 io.swagger.v3.oas.models.security.SecurityScheme
|
static String |
getRealIp()
获取本地真正的IP地址,即获得有线或者无线WiFi地址。
|
public static String getRealIp()
public static BuildSecuritySchemes buildSecuritySchemes(List<SwaggerSecurityScheme> swaggerSecuritySchemes)
参考 HTTP 身份验证 API key (作为 Header 或 查询参数) OAuth2 的通用流程(implicit, password, application and access code),如RFC6749 OpenID Connect Discovery 在 java 中的抽象类型对应 io.swagger.v3.oas.models.security.SecurityScheme
Copyright © 2024 tan. All rights reserved.